Our client is a manufacturer of high end products based in Rustington, they are seeking a versatile Shop Floor Production Manager to oversee their manufacturing process and ensure efficiency and quality in our production operations.

The role comprises production, personnel and site management, together with an analytical and strategic element aimed at cost reduction and increased productivity, while ensuring health and safety, compliance and product quality.

Hours:

  • Monday -Thursday 7.30am to 5.00pm and Friday 7.30am to 11.30am.

Responsibilities:

  • Develop and implement production strategies to meet company objective
  • Manage and optimize production schedules to meet customer demands
  • Oversee the supply and upholstery process to ensure timely completion of products
  • Implement quality control measures to maintain high product standards
  • Identify areas for continuous improvement and implement solutions
  • Utilize knowledge to troubleshoot production issues and optimize processes

Production

  • Weekly production plans: Ensure that there is sufficient staff for the level of work
  • Factory Flow and Layout: Understand the requirements of the factory and make any changes required to maximise efficiency
  • Inventory Control: Ensure that you have accurate stock figures, that the stock is in the right place at the right time, that there is sufficient space to hold it and that space is utilise correctly
  • Work collaboratively with the General Manager & Directors to support the introduction of new products
  • Play an active role in minimising raw material waste

Personnel

  • Carry out regular staff appraisals with all shop floor personnel
  • Formulate training plans for both new starters and current staff so that we increase skills and capabilities in the factory
  • Drive the teamwork, morale, culture, and productivity of the company

Site

  • Maintain calendar of works to ensure all site and machinery servicing is undertaken at the correct intervals and information is available as and when required by both internal and external stakeholders
  • Ensure all site maintenance issues or breakdowns are resolved quickly and safely and communicated where appropriate to the Directors’

Health and Safety and Compliance

  • Health and Safety: From ensuring that the correct Risk Assessments are in place and are being followed to ensuring that the necessary people are trained in their departments for the tasks at hand
  • Compliance: To ensure all compliance requirements are being followed in areas such as FSC, Flammability regulations, COSHH and any future developments

Analysis and Strategy

  • Develop, implement, and successfully conclude cost reduction programmes together with the Planner and the General Manager
  • Visualisation of KPIs for factory staff – attendance, production achievement vs targets

Health and Safety, Compliance, Quality Control

  • Report to the Directors regularly with status of the factory with regards to the above areas
  • Bring complex issues to the Directors: explain the issue and propose potential solutions for the Directors to discuss and agree
